OPW Fueling Components has appointed Fernando Whitaker to the newly created position of managing director-Latin America

OPW Fueling Components has appointed Fernando Whitaker to the newly created position of managing director-Latin America. He joined OPW in October 2006 as managing director, OPW Brazil. He will be based at the company's Itatiba, Brazil facility. Earlier this year, he assumed management responsibilities for the joint operation of two Dover companies, OPW Fueling Components and OPW Fluid Transfer Group in Brazil. Luis Barriga, OPW's regional sales director for Latin America, will be responsible for sales of all OPW products made in the United States and Brazil.

Heil Trailer International (HTI) has promoted Bill Harris to corporate business development manager. Before his current assignment, he was working with Heil's Defense Products Group as the military business development manager. HTI has appointed Cory Gerlach as director-supply chain based in the Athens TN corporate offices. Gerlach most recently served as Mastercraft Boat Company's supply chain leader. HTI has named Robert Lane director-product management, Bryan Yielding director-product development, and Mike Byrum defense engineering specialist in the Athens manufacturing offices.

After nearly six decades in the business, Ottis Kyle is retiring from The Jack Olsta Co. Kyle started in the industry in 1950, when he took a position as Houston TX-based salesman with Fruehauf, rising to the level of branch manager before leaving the firm in 1986. The Jack Olsta Co hired Kyle in 1991, where he served as the company's Houston-area sales agent.

Hino Trucks announced the appointment of Robert “Bob” E McDowell as senior vice-president, sales and customer support. He succeeds Dominick “Nick” Vermet, who will return to a position with a stakeholder of Hino Trucks. McDowell was previously employed for 23 years by Mitsubishi Fuso Truck of America Inc, most recently as president and chief executive officer.
